본문 바로가기

카테고리 없음

인터넷의 지형을 탐색하며 항해하는 길잡이

1. 인터넷의 기원과 발전

ARPANET의 탄생

1960년대 말, 미 국방부의 고등연구계획국(ARPA)은 연구자들이 컴퓨터를 통해 정보를 공유할 수 있는 네트워크를 개발하기 위한 프로젝트를 진행했다. 이 프로젝트로 인해 1969년 ARPANET이 탄생하게 되었다. ARPANET은 패킷 스위칭 기술을 사용하여 여러 대의 컴퓨터를 연결하고, 정보를 빠르게 교환할 수 있는 환경을 제공했다.

TCP/IP 프로토콜의 등장

1970년대 중반, ARPANET을 통해 데이터를 전송할 때 사용되던 NCP(Network Control Protocol)는 기능의 제한적이었다. 그러나 1983년 TCP/IP 프로토콜이 도입되면서 효율적인 데이터 전송이 가능해졌다. TCP는 데이터의 신뢰성을 보장하고, IP는 데이터를 패킷 단위로 분할하고 목적지로 전송하는 역할을 담당했다. TCP/IP 프로토콜은 현재 인터넷에서 기본적으로 사용되는 프로토콜이다.

월드 와이드 웹의 등장

1990년대 초반, 팀 버너스리(Tim Berners-Lee)가 월드 와이드 웹(WWW)을 개발하면서 인터넷은 대중화되기 시작했다. 웹은 하이퍼텍스트 문서로 이루어진 페이지를 인터넷을 통해 전송하고, 하이퍼링크를 통해 문서들 사이를 쉽게 이동할 수 있게 해주었다. 이러한 기술의 도입으로 인터넷은 정보를 더욱 쉽게 공유하고 탐색할 수 있는 플랫폼으로 발전하였다.

인터넷의 확산과 발전

1990년대 중반부터 2000년대 초반까지 인터넷은 급격히 보급되었으며, 다양한 서비스들이 등장하였다. 전자우편, 인터넷 검색 엔진, 온라인 쇼핑 등 인터넷의 활용 범위가 점차 확대되었고, 이는 인터넷의 발전을 가속화시켰다. 또한, 모바일 기기의 보급과 더불어 무선 인터넷 기술의 발전으로 언제 어디서나 인터넷을 이용할 수 있는 환경이 갖추어졌다.

요약하자면, 인터넷은 ARPANET에서 시작하여 TCP/IP 프로토콜과 웹의 등장으로 더욱 발전하였다. 그 결과, 인터넷은 전 세계에 보급되어 다양한 서비스를 제공하고 정보를 공유하는 중요한 플랫폼이 되었다.

2. 인터넷의 구성 요소

2.1. 클라이언트와 서버

인터넷은 클라이언트와 서버 사이의 상호작용으로 이루어진다. 클라이언트는 사용자가 요청하는 정보를 제공받는 컴퓨터나 장치를 말하며, 서버는 클라이언트의 요청에 응답하여 정보를 제공하는 컴퓨터나 장치를 말한다. 클라이언트와 서버는 HTTP(HyperText Transfer Protocol)와 같은 프로토콜을 사용하여 통신하며, 이를 통해 웹 페이지를 요청하고 전송하는 것이 가능하다.

2.2. 인터넷 서비스 제공자(ISP)

인터넷 서비스 제공자(ISP)는 사용자에게 인터넷 접속 서비스를 제공하는 기업이나 단체를 말한다. ISP는 사용자가 인터넷에 접속할 수 있도록 회선을 제공하여 인터넷 트래픽을 주고받을 수 있게 한다. ISP는 일반 가정에서 사용하는 가정용 인터넷 서비스부터 기업이나 기관에서 사용하는 업무용 인터넷 서비스까지 다양한 형태의 서비스를 제공한다.

2.3. 라우터와 네트워크

라우터는 인터넷에서 데이터를 전송하는 역할을 하는 장치이다. 라우터는 데이터 패킷을 받아 목적지까지 최적의 경로로 전송하는 역할을 담당한다. 라우터는 여러 개의 네트워크를 연결하여 인터넷을 형성하며, 이를 통해 사용자들은 다른 네트워크로 연결되어 있는 컴퓨터나 서버와 통신할 수 있다.

2.4. 프로토콜과 IP 주소

인터넷에서 컴퓨터나 장치들은 서로 통신하기 위해 프로토콜을 사용한다. 프로토콜은 데이터의 전송 방식이나 형식, 규칙 등을 정의한 것이다. TCP/IP 프로토콜은 인터넷에서 가장 중요한 프로토콜로, 데이터의 전송과정을 다루며 패킷의 분할과 재조립, 에러 체크 등 다양한 기능을 제공한다. 또한, 인터넷 상에서 각 컴퓨터나 장치를 식별하기 위해 IP 주소가 사용된다. IP 주소는 각 컴퓨터에게 부여된 고유한 식별자로, 패킷을 전송할 때 목적지를 찾기 위해 사용된다.

요약하자면, 인터넷은 클라이언트와 서버, ISP, 라우터와 네트워크, 프로토콜과 IP 주소 등 다양한 요소로 구성되어 있다. 이러한 요소들이 함께 동작하여 인터넷이 정상적으로 동작하고 사용자들은 정보를 교환하고 서비스를 이용할 수 있다.

3. 인터넷을 효과적으로 탐색하는 방법

3.1. 검색 엔진 활용

검색 엔진은 사용자의 검색어에 맞는 웹 페이지를 찾아주는 도구이다. 가장 많이 사용되는 검색 엔진은 구글(Google)이지만, 네이버, 다음 등 다양한 검색 엔진이 있다. 효과적인 검색을 위해서는 검색어를 명확하게 입력하고, 관련 키워드를 추가하여 검색 결과의 정확도를 높일 수 있다. 또한, 검색 결과의 신뢰성을 평가하기 위해 신뢰할 수 있는 웹사이트로부터 정보를 확인하는 것이 중요하다.

3.2. 북마크 및 탭 활용

인터넷 탐색 중에 유용한 웹 페이지를 나중에 다시 찾기 위해 북마크 기능을 활용할 수 있다. 북마크는 즐겨찾기(Bookmark)라고도 불리며, 해당 웹 페이지를 빠르게 찾아볼 수 있는 기능이다. 또한, 여러 개의 웹 페이지를 동시에 열어두고 전환하여 사용하기 위해 탭을 활용할 수 있다. 탭을 이용하면 한 번에 여러 개의 웹 페이지를 열어서 효율적으로 정보를 탐색할 수 있다.

3.3. 사이트 내 검색 기능 활용

특정 웹 사이트 내에서 원하는 정보를 빠르게 찾기 위해서는 사이트 내 검색 기능을 활용할 수 있다. 많은 웹 사이트들은 상단이나 하단에 검색 창을 제공하고 있으며, 해당 사이트에 대한 검색 결과를 제공하는 기능이다. 이를 이용하면 해당 웹 사이트의 내부 정보를 더욱 정확하고 효율적으로 탐색할 수 있다.

3.4. 효율적인 탐색 습관

인터넷을 효과적으로 탐색하기 위해서는 몇 가지 습관을 가질 수 있다. 첫째, 검색 결과 페이지에서 관련성이 높은 정보를 빠르게 찾기 위해 제목과 요약 정보를 잘 살펴보는 것이 중요하다. 둘째, 신뢰할 수 있는 출처의 정보를 선택하는 것이 신뢰성을 높일 수 있다. 셋째, 효율적인 검색을 위한 검색어의 조합과 필터링 기능을 적극 활용할 수 있다. 넷째, 목적에 맞는 웹 사이트를 선택하고 해당 사이트 내에서 정보를 찾는 것이 탐색의 효율성을 높일 수 있다.

요약하자면, 효과적인 인터넷 탐색을 위해서는 검색 엔진을 활용하고, 북마크 및 탭을 활용하여 유용한 웹 페이지를 관리할 수 있다. 또한, 사이트 내 검색 기능을 활용하고 효율적인 탐색 습관을 가지는 것이 중요하다. 이를 통해 사용자는 보다 정확하고 신속한 정보 검색을 할 수 있다.